Driver / Administration Assistant Job in Kenya – Foreign Embassy (KShs 56-61K)

The Australian High Commission (AHC), Nairobi is seeking applications from suitably qualified individuals for the delivery of quality Driving Services and to undertake a range of Administration Assistant duties.

Duties

As a driver and administration assistant for the High Commission, the successful applicant will perform the following duties:
  • Perform work in the operation of a vehicle to ensure safe transportation of AHC personnel and other designated clients to and from various destinations and to assist clients on entry and exit from vehicles as necessary.

  • Maintain a variety of records, for example, vehicle log sheets, vehicle requisition forms.
  • Plan journey routes ahead of assignments and reassess as required to prevailing road and/or security conditions.
  • Drive Head of Mission on a rotational basis
  • Independent judgment must be exercised in handling unplanned ad-hoc situations.
  • Assume responsibility for care and maintenance of AHC fleet vehicles; wash vehicles and clean interior; take AHC fleet vehicles to garage for maintenance and repair.
  • Request and provide quotes from service providers.
  • Provide general maintenance assistance to owned and leased property.
  • Provide administrative support as directed.
  • Undertake driver training as required.
Applications (a cover letter of maximum two pages, and CV of maximum two pages) should address the following selection criteria:
  • Possession of a valid driver’s license issued by the Registrar of Motor Vehicles, Nairobi Kenya.
  • Must have a clean driving record, able to obtain a CDL (commercial drivers license) if necessary, ability to certify in special needs assistance training, defensive driver training, armoured vehicle driver training, and first aid.
  • Working knowledge of the rules and regulations involved in the safe and efficient operation of automotive equipment.
  • Good knowledge of all parts of Nairobi and regional districts.
  • Knowledge of basic automotive maintenance procedures.
  • Ability to operate a 4WD vehicle.
  • Ability to lift weights of up to 32kgs
  • High level IT skills, including familiarity with Microsoft Office
  • High level verbal and written communication skills.
  • High level organisational and coordination skills.
Salary

Starting monthly salary will be in the range of Kes.56,010 - 61,776 depending on qualifications and experience.

There will be an expectation of availability to work overtime (paid) on a regular basis as required.
